If this, then that...

The scriptures are full of conditional logic.

September 20, 2018

I've noticed a pattern in scriptures that are meaningful to me: they almost always contain conditional logic, usually in this form:

If you do 'X', then you'll get 'Y'.

Of course, a lot of our behavior is based on numerous instances of this pattern observed over the course of our lives. Computational logic is the foundation of so many helpful things, including all of the software we interact with on an almost constant basis (even some light bulbs have software in them nowadays). There are even services that will employ such logic to connect facets of our digital lives for convenience or getting work done.

So, I'll use this document as a place to curate my favoriate such references in the scriptures.
